Presets Explained
Ultra: Reduces performance somewhat to boost clarity & reduce temporal motion smearing as much as possible
High: Performance will remain the same or nearly the same, while still cutting down on temporal motion smearing & boosting clarity
Installation
1. Download the mod & unzip it, then select the preset you want
2. Put the ini files found inside your selected preset where your games
ini's files are located & overwrite if it asks you to (if you added
other commands from different mods you'll need to add them manually by
copying & pasting the commands in)
3. Launch the game & select TSR as your anti-aliasing/upscaling solution
Note: This will look better than TAA, FSR3, DLSS3, & XeSS2, so use TSR + this mod over those! I only recommend using the DLSS/FSR/XeSS version if you have access to DLSS4 or FSR4. But even then you need to compare DLSS4/FSR4 vs the tweaked TSR yourself as it does do some things better than them and some things worse, so you may actually prefer it
ini Location
C:\Users\User\Documents\My Games\Oblivion Remastered\Saved\Config\Windows
C:\Users\User\Documents\My Games\Oblivion Remastered\Saved\Config\WinGDK
